Blockchain technology is revolutionizing the way we think about money and payments. At Smarty Pay, we leverage blockchain's core principles—security, transparency, and decentralization—to create seamless crypto payment solutions.
In this article, we’ll break down the basics of blockchain and explain the key concepts and mechanics behind how our system works.

1. What Is a Blockchain?
A blockchain is a decentralized, digital ledger that records transactions in a secure and transparent way. Unlike traditional financial systems that rely on centralized entities like banks, blockchains operate on a network of computers (nodes) that validate and store data.
Key features of blockchain:
Decentralization: No single entity controls the system.
Transparency: Transactions are publicly recorded and verifiable.
Immutability: Once data is recorded, it cannot be altered or deleted.
2. Crypto Addresses: Where Transactions Happen
A crypto address is like a bank account number on the blockchain. It's a unique identifier that allows you to send, receive, and store cryptocurrencies. At Smarty Pay, customers use crypto addresses to make payments or receive funds.
Public Address: This is what you share with others to receive payments.
Private Key: A secret code that gives you access to your funds. It’s crucial to keep this private and secure, as anyone with your private key can control your funds.
3. Wallets: Managing Your Crypto
A crypto wallet is a tool that stores your private keys and allows you to interact with blockchain networks. It’s essential for making transactions, signing smart contracts, and accessing decentralized applications (dApps).
Types of wallets:
Hot Wallets: Connected to the internet (e.g., MetaMask, Trust Wallet). Convenient but more vulnerable to hacking.
Cold Wallets: Offline wallets (e.g., hardware wallets like Ledger). Highly secure but less accessible.
Smarty Pay works seamlessly with Web3 wallets like MetaMask and WalletConnect, enabling users to make payments or manage subscriptions directly from their wallets.
4. Connecting to a dApp: Accessing Blockchain Services
A dApp (decentralized application) is an application that runs on a blockchain network. At Smarty Pay, our payment system acts as a dApp that connects users’ wallets to our smart contracts.
Here’s how the connection works:
A user opens the Smarty Pay payment widget.
The widget prompts the user to connect their Web3 wallet (e.g., MetaMask).
Once connected, the wallet interacts with our smart contracts to initiate and complete transactions.
This interaction ensures that payments are secure, decentralized, and fully transparent.
5. Transaction Signing: Authorizing Payments
When making a payment, users must sign the transaction with their wallet. Signing is the process of authorizing the transfer of funds using the wallet’s private key.
Why it’s secure:
The private key never leaves the wallet, and only a cryptographic signature is shared with the blockchain.
The transaction is validated by the network, ensuring it meets the blockchain’s rules.
At Smarty Pay, transaction signing guarantees that payments are initiated only by the wallet owner, enhancing security and preventing unauthorized access.
6. Security: Why Blockchain Is So Safe
Blockchain’s security lies in its design:
Encryption: Transactions are encrypted, protecting data from tampering.
Decentralization: With no single point of failure, hacking the system is nearly impossible.
Smart Contracts: Programs on the blockchain that automatically execute when predefined conditions are met. At Smarty Pay, smart contracts ensure payments are processed reliably and securely.
How Smarty Pay Leverages Blockchain Basics
At Smarty Pay, we’ve built our payment system to harness these blockchain fundamentals:
Smart Contracts: Handle payments, subscriptions, and payouts autonomously.
Web3 Wallet Integration: Enables users to connect wallets and sign transactions securely.
Transparent Rates: During Pay-Ins, users see real-time conversion rates before making payments.
Non-Custodial System: Merchants retain full control of their funds, as we never hold user or client assets.
By combining these mechanics, Smarty Pay offers a robust, secure, and user-friendly platform that simplifies crypto payments for merchants and customers alike.
Conclusion
Understanding the basics of blockchain is key to appreciating how crypto payment systems like Smarty Pay operate. From crypto addresses and wallets to dApp connections and transaction signing, blockchain technology provides the foundation for a secure and decentralized payment solution.
As the world moves further into the era of digital payments, Smarty Pay is here to make blockchain-based transactions as simple and seamless as traditional methods.
Curious to learn more? Explore our products or book a call with us to see how we can help your business embrace crypto payments. 🚀